Evodiamine, Zingerone, and Raspberry ketone

These
three compounds all belong to the same class of compounds known as
vanilloid receptor agonists. They work by enhancing the release and
potentiating the action of norepinephrine, also known as adrenaline.
Scientific studies have shown that these compounds increase energy
expenditure and promote the loss of body fat.
Green Coffee Extract

Green
Coffee Bean Extract is abundant in polyphenols and is known to be one
of the richest sources of anti-oxidants available. One of the
polyphenols is called chlorogenic acid and it has been shown to enhance
the burning of fat for energy in the liver. Chlorogenic acid can also
help lower blood pressure by enhancing the vasodilation response of
blood vessels in the body.
Kaempferol

This
flavonoid was recently discovered to increase muscle cell oxygen
consumption through dramatically increasing cyclic AMP levels as well
as up-regulating the level of T3-deiodinase and extending the half-life
of triiodothyronine (T3).
Coleus Forskohlii Extract

Forskolin
is a chemical found in Coleus Forskohlii extract. It activates the
enzyme adenylyl cyclase, which increases production of the cellular
messenger cyclic AMP. Cyclic AMP is an integral part of the lipolytic
signaling pathway for norepinephrine.
Fursultiamine

Thiamine
is one of the most important vitamins for carbohydrate and fat
metabolism but it suffers from poor bioavailability. That is why
easily absorbed thiamine pro-drugs were developed and fursultiamine is
the most effective of them all. Cellular ATP production in muscles and
the brain are greatly enhanced with fursultiamine, and it has been
shown to improve exercise performance and reduce muscle fatigue.
Fursultiamine is also known to reduce or eliminate the accelerated
heartbeat that often accompanies the use of stimulants such as
ephedrine. |
